Key Features I Looked At
- Video Quality: I found the 4K video recording useful for capturing sharp footage.
- Image Stabilization: I liked that it helps smooth out shaky shots during movement.
- Voice Control: This made it easier for me to start recording hands-free.
- Waterproof Design: I appreciated not having to use an extra housing for basic water protection.
- Touchscreen: The rear touchscreen made navigation easier for me.

Things I Think About Before Buying
Before buying the Hero 5, I always think about battery life, accessory compatibility, and whether the features match how I plan to use it. If I want longer recording sessions, I know I may need extra batteries. I also check whether I need mounts, memory cards, or protective accessories for my setup.
